Actress Jun Ji Hyun gave a hundred thousand dollars for those involved in the sinking of the ferry Sewol. On April 29, 2014, the Korea Red Cross said, "A person named Wang Ji Hyun gave a hundred thousand dollars for the ferry Sewol incident and the families of those involved in the incident." The Korean Red Cross said they realized actress Jun Ji Hyun has given for the ferry incident when they were reconfirming the large amounts of money sent to them for the ferry incident. Actress Jun Ji Hyun said, "I feel so terrible whenever I hear the news about the unfortunate students and their families. I really want the families who are left to not lose hope. It is from my small heart, but I want to share the pain of the families of the involved." Previously, actress Jun Ji Hyun canceled her event in Myung Dong on April 17, 2014, to show her condolences for the ferry incident. In 2012 when Jun Ji Hyun got married, she donated all of the money she received as a congratulations to a charity as well.
